In the rapidly evolving world of technology, mobile applications have become indispensable for businesses and individuals alike. Developing a high-quality mobile app requires expertise, creativity, and a deep understanding of the latest trends. Therefore success, it's crucial to team up with a reputable mobile app development company that possesses the necessary skills and experience.
- Many factors should be considered when evaluating a mobile app development company.
- Expertise in developing similar apps is essential.
- A portfolio showcasing previous projects can provide valuable insights into the company's capabilities.
- Open communication is crucial for a smooth development process.
- Moreover, evaluate factors such as project timeline, budget, and customer support.
Researching different companies and reading online reviews can help you make an informed decision.
Developing App Costs: A Thorough Look
Embarking on the journey of app creation can be both exciting and daunting. While the potential rewards are immense, it's crucial to have a clear understanding of the financial implications involved. The cost of developing an app is influenced by a multitude of factors, ranging mobile software development company from the sophistication of the app's features to the skillset of the development team.
- A simple app with limited functionality can be developed relatively inexpensively, while a complex enterprise-level application with advanced tools will naturally command a higher price tag.
- The choice of platform, whether it's iOS, Android, or both, also plays a role in the overall cost. Each platform has its own set of requirements, which can impact development time and resources.
- Furthermore, factors such as design, user interface (UI), and user experience (UX) elements can add to the expense. A well-designed app that provides a seamless and intuitive user experience is essential for success.
Android App Development Strategies for Seamless Execution
Developing a smooth and efficient Android app requires a well-structured approach. First and foremost, choose the right development tools that align with your project's scale. Mastering this tools will empower you to create a solid foundation for your app. Additionally, fine-tune code performance by implementing efficient algorithms and data structures. Regularly test your app on various devices and screen resolutions to ensure consistent functionality. Finally, embrace best practices for memory management and background processes to ensure a seamless user experience.
Crafting Innovative Mobile Phone Applications: A Step-by-Step Approach
The mobile phone application market is incredibly dynamic. To stand out, developers must create innovative and intuitive applications that captivate users. A step-by-step approach can help you navigate the development process and bring your concept to life.
- Begin by defining a problem that your application can address.
- Conduct thorough market research to understand user needs and the existing apps.
- Design a clear and concise feature list that solves user desires.
- Create wireframes and mockups to visualize the user interface.
- Choose the appropriate programming language based on your app's features.
- Write clean, optimized code that is future-proof.
- Validate your application thoroughly on various devices to ensure a smooth user experience.
- Launch your application to the app stores and monitor its performance.
- Continuously iterate your application based on user suggestions and market demands.
Creating Mobile Apps: Balancing Cost and Functionality
The sphere of mobile app development poses a constant challenge: finding the perfect balance between cost and functionality. While feature-rich apps can impress users, their creation often comes with a hefty price tag. On the other hand, budget-conscious apps may lack certain attractive features that could elevate user experience. This quandary demands a calculated approach to app development, where developers carefully evaluate the expectations of their target audience and allocate resources accordingly.
- Additionally, it's essential to prioritize core functionalities that provide the most utility to users. By focusing on essential features and streamlining development processes, developers can create high-quality apps that meet user needs without going beyond budget constraints.
The future of Mobile: Trends in App Development
The mobile landscape is in constant flux, transforming dramatically. Developers must remain vigilant with the latest trends to design impactful apps. One key trend is the growing demand for AR and VR applications. Users desire engagement more than just flat interfaces. Another significant shift is the emphasis on machine learning integration. Apps are becoming smarter, able to personalize individual user needs.
- Cross-platform development
- The Internet of Things (IoT)
- Decentralized applications
These are just some of the trends shaping the future of mobile app development. As technology continues to advance, we can expect even more groundbreaking developments in the years to come.